Transaction 71a11e4a20b9f39fed75ba320bf4e0a6404fce10cb245c4ee475cb27ca0db729

10 Input
1 Outputs
  • 71a11e4a20b9f39fed75ba320bf4e0a6404fce10cb245c4ee475cb27ca0db729:0
  • value  70516331
    address  3EpY373qr4fLdcR4xi2QZBte4dd3LwM5Qq